AMD Athlon II X4 630: specs and benchmarks

AMD started Athlon II X4 630 sales on September 2009 at a recommended price of $63. This is a Propus architecture desktop processor primarily aimed at office systems. It has 4 cores and 4 threads, and is based on 45 nm manufacturing technology, with a maximum frequency of 2800 MHz and a locked multiplier.

Compatibility-wise, this is AMD Socket AM3 processor with a TDP of 95 Watt. It supports DDR3 memory.

It provides poor benchmark performance at 1.69% of a leader's which is AMD EPYC 9654.

Information on Athlon II X4 630 compatibility with other computer components and devices: motherboard (look for socket type), power supply unit (look for power consumption) etc. Useful when planning a future computer configuration or upgrading an existing one. Note that power consumption of some processors can well exceed their nominal TDP, even without overclocking. Some can even double their declared thermals given that the motherboard allows to tune the CPU power parameters.

Passmark CPU Mark is a widespread benchmark, consisting of 8 different types of workload, including integer and floating point math, extended instructions, compression, encryption and physics calculation. There is also one separate single-threaded scenario measuring single-core performance.
